Q: Is 11,236,064 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 11,236,064 is not a prime number.

Why is 11,236,064 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 11236064 can be evenly divided by 1 2 4 7 8 14 16 28 32 56 103 112 206 224 412 487 721 824 974 1,442 1,648 1,948 2,884 3,296 3,409 3,896 5,768 6,818 7,792 11,536 13,636 15,584 23,072 27,272 50,161 54,544 100,322 109,088 200,644 351,127 401,288 702,254 802,576 1,404,508 1,605,152 2,809,016 5,618,032 and 11,236,064, with no remainder.

Since 11,236,064 cannot be divided by just 1 and 11,236,064, it is not a prime number.
